The Casady Annual Fund's Importance
There is a funding gap of $5,000 per student. This is 4% of our budget. The Casady Annual Fund is critically important to funding Casady School’s operating costs every year.
The Casady Annual Fund is our most valuable source of unrestricted philanthropic support. Unrestricted support goes directly to the area of greatest need and has a direct impact on our students, our faculty, and our mission. It enables talented young people from every culture and community to attend Casady, regardless of their family's income level. It supports everything on campus - from program enhancements, classroom improvements, and competitive salaries for dedicated faculty to general campus maintenance.
The Annual Fund contributes to all operating costs of Casady School, including hiring and retaining the best faculty, offering new and elevated programming, keeping up with technological advances, providing financial aid to our families, and much more.
Tuition and fees do not cover the full cost of a Casady education and the Annual Fund exists to close that gap. The Annual Fund helps to keep tuition lower than it might otherwise be. Every student benefits from gifts to the Annual Fund.
